Howa wa heya

Howa wa Heya, (“Him and Her”, “ هو و هي” ) is an Egyptian television drama, that aired for the first time during Ramadan in 1985. It featured many prominent contemporary artists in key roles, with movie stars Soad Hosni, in her sole television role, and Ahmed Zaki. The married couple drama, or dramas rather, were written by Sanaa al-Bisi and adapted by Salah Jahin into a screenplay in a rare anthology series in Egyptian television, where the same actors played different characters and storylines in each of its ten episodes. Hosni was awarded the Transtel (now part of Deutsche Welle) Prize at the African Union of Broadcasting conference in 1985 for her role in the series.
